python 使用索引访问list元素
时间: 2024-02-25 10:39:43 浏览: 21
好的,可以回答这个问题。在 Python 中,可以使用索引来访问 list 的元素。例如,list_name[index] 可以返回该 list 中索引为 index 的元素。需要注意的是,Python 中的索引是从 0 开始的,也就是说,第一个元素的索引是 0,第二个元素的索引是 1,以此类推。如果索引超出了 list 的长度,Python 会抛出 IndexError 错误。
相关问题
通过索引访问list python
在 Python 中,可以通过索引访问列表中的元素。列表中的第一个元素的索引为 0,第二个元素的索引为 1,以此类推。
例如,如果有一个名为 my_list 的列表,可以使用以下代码访问它的第一个元素:
```
my_list[0]
```
如果要访问列表的第二个元素,可以使用以下代码:
```
my_list[1]
```
以此类推。同时,还可以使用负数索引来从列表的末尾开始访问元素。例如,可以使用以下代码访问列表的最后一个元素:
```
my_list[-1]
```
python按索引删除列表元素
可以使用`del`语句来按索引删除列表元素,例如:
```python
my_list = [1, 2, 3, 4, 5]
del my_list[2] # 删除索引为2的元素,即第3个元素
print(my_list) # 输出 [1, 2, 4, 5]
```
也可以使用`pop`方法来删除指定索引的元素并返回该元素的值,例如:
```python
my_list = [1, 2, 3, 4, 5]
removed_element = my_list.pop(2) # 删除索引为2的元素,即第3个元素,并返回该元素的值
print(removed_element) # 输出 3
print(my_list) # 输出 [1, 2, 4, 5]
```